LEVC - Valencia-Manises

Valencia-Manises is one of my favorite routes so this scenery is always on my route list, in either routing from EGKK (Gatwick) or EGSS (Standsted) in the UK or LIRF in Rome, Italy. The LIRF - LEVC service is one of my test routes and this quick run over the western Mediterranean is one I do quite often.

The airport is crowded in by the default buildings around it, so you have to account for that with your settings as they can hit your framerate. But what they take away in power is worth it by the great feeling of a city around you. But the airport has great animations and autogates and good traffic animation around it, so you always feel welcome here. DAI-Media's best aspects are their terminals, and the LEVC terminal is excellent with great design and a perfect representation of this building and its features with the swooped curved roof of the new T2 domestic terminal a standout.

 

post-2-0-36576300-1430367309_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-29456400-1430367312_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-62947500-1430367315_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-71069000-1430367322_thumb.jpg

 

I try to time my arrivals at dawn or dusk, as not only is there a great view from the aircraft of the surrounding mountains, but the approach to runway 30 is simply great over the harbour, then the city and finally the landing finals over the highway, do it at night with HDR on and you are in for a treat and the lighting on the ramps is also excellent.

The updates this year (2015) comprise of:

- Corrections regional terminal roof

- Change chain fence for concrete fence

- Fix PAPI light on rwy 30

- Expanded taxiway in line with changes of actual taxiway states.

- Update runway guards and holding positions

- Changed grass, and some other misc textures

- Add ATC Flow and fix and expand atc route

- Some others bugs fixed

- Add exclusion for compatibility with Gateway airport.

- Changed visual Ads (signage)

- Fix lights where taxiway cross rwy 30

- Add Skyline Library

- Add shadows terminal and optimise terminal building, fix texture - Add more decals, more vegetation, oranges trees

- Populate port with ships, containers, cranes.

- Add volumetric effects on taxisigns

- Some others bug fixed and improvements

And you notice the updates, mostly with the new port and shipping on the approach, the fixed ATC flow is now excellent as well and far better than the wayward original tracks around the airport. And you don't get the "Global Gateway" version sticking out of the old terminal buildings.

So LEVC - Valencia-Manises is an excellent investment and even a must have if you fly around the Mediterranean...

LRSB - Sibiu International

Sibiu is positioned deep with in the valley surrounded by the Carpathian Mountains in Romania. Regular routes here are from LROP - Budapest, EDDM - Munich and LOWW - Vienna. Lufthansa Regional and WIZZ will keep you busy. I run a loop from LOWW to LRSB then to LRTR and return to LOWW as a sort of charter pickup trip for international onward connections out of Vienna. (You have to admit I have a brilliant imagination). But it is in fact a great service. Mostly the CRJ200 equipment is better here, but today I am using the Airbus A320 series as I want time on the aircraft.

The airport of Sibiu is an important cultural center of Romania, and tourists are finding their way there now more and more in bigger numbers each year. This is good well crafted scenery, as noted the terminal is again the highlight, but mostly the scenery is full of objects and details.

The ramps feel more empty than I thought they were? But the images in the review say the same story. Highlight is the great Șoseaua Alba Iulia (Highways 1 & 7) which are very well set out and are perfectly set into the airport scenery and making this scenery very animated.  Not a lot of animations on the ramps still though....

 

post-2-0-33236700-1430370702_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-53161400-1430370705_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-67064600-1430370710_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-49189100-1430370715_thumb.jpg

 

Night lighting is excellent with the airport having great coverage and the ramp area is excellent...  arrival and departures are great in low light as the runway/taxiways are both very well lit. The signage lighting is a standout feature here.

The updates comprise of:

– Fix some Bugs,

– Add more shared objects

– Add mesh correction.

- LRSB - Aeroportul International Sibiu Mesh/ be down to: SCENERY_PACK Custom Scenery/DAI Media Scenery - LRSB - Aeroportul International Sibiu/

– Fix chart links

– Fix some taxi edges light and bars

– Excludes conflicts with HD Mesh 2

– Some textures update to more details

– Others small bug fixes.

– Reconfigure boundary for flattering control on mesh when “runway follow terrain contours” enabled , and Lights fix

– Reconfigure ILS runway 27. (See the point 7 for fix)

– Some small bug fixes.

Surprisingly the RWY 27 Alignment is still out but a fix is noted in the manual. And note the position of the Sibiu Mesh folder must be below the main scenery folder in the Custom Scenery ini order unless you want no scenery on landing.

For value LRSB-Sibiu is still very good and great value at only 14.00 €.

LRTR - "Traian Vuia" Timişoara

LRTR is a short hop directly west from Sibiu and only an easily under the hour flight. Timişoara "Traian Vuia" International (also known as Giarmata Airport) is Romania's third largest airport and DAI-Media's very first project. It feels far more active than Sibiu straight away, although I was not sure of the aircraft parking? one aircraft blocked the way on to the ramp and the others were all aligned facing outwards, correct of course but they make it hard to turn around and park.

 

Highlights of all DAI-Media sceneries are the very well meshed in photo-scenery (orthos) to the surrounding default X-Plane scenery. I will note that the realism of this aspect was why I was attracted to DAI-Media's work, no other scenery designers get this intermesh as good as these people do, when you cross the fence to land then any visual aspect is perfect...  as it should be.

So the detailing and objects are first rate and the airport terminal (again) and signage are the highlights. Make sure that the "mesh " is below the actual scenery unless you want another blank area on landing. Grass and fence features are also first rate thoughout all these sceneries, it is this sort of detailing that is what you pay for.

 

post-2-0-44502800-1430372486_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-91352100-1430372488_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-94781100-1430372491_thumb.jpgpost-2-0-66392700-1430372496_thumb.jpg

 

Night lighting is excellent. I arrived very early in the morning and the airport looked great. Ramp lighting is perfect but throughout all of the scenery the lighting is very good.

– Correct Airport Name & some ground marks.

– Exclusion extended to fix errors with Treelines Farms Europe v2 & HD Global Scenery2

– Fix mesh and altitude. Please be sure that Mesh folder have lower priority than Scenery folder, this can cause incorrect load of scenery, for sure please take a look to your “scenery_packs.ini” in your Custom Scenery and be sure that the line: SCENERY_PACK Custom Scenery/DAI Media Scenery - LRTR - Timisoara Traian Vuia Mesh/ be down to: SCENERY_PACK Custom Scenery/DAI Media Scenery - LRTR - Timisoara Traian Vuia/

– Added tower point view

– Some others minors bugs fixed.

improvements in grass, texturing, modeling, without killing fps

Animations are excellent with opening hangar doors between certain hours and a stop bars for when taxiing until clearance is given from the tower. There could be more ramp animations though, as that is now more of a requirement when purchasing modern X-Plane scenery.
